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
shpor_skul.docx
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
79.12 Кб
Скачать

Ole db (Object Linking және Embedding Database) – технологияларына түсінік.

Microsoft фирмасының COM технологиясы  OLE 1 (Object Linking and Embedding обьектілерді  байланыстыру және ендіру) технологиясының  дамуы болып табылады.  COM технологиясы  кезкелген типтегі бағдарламалар  (библиотекалар, қосымшалар, операциондық  жүйелер), байланысының жалпы схемасын  анықтайды, яғни БҚАМ-ның бір бөлшегіне, екінші бөлшекте тағайындалған функцияларды қолдануға мүмкіндік береді. COM технологиясы бойынша қосымшалар - арнайы COM класстарының даналары болатын COM обьектілерін қолдана отырып - өз қызметтерін ұсынады.OLE- automation немесе Automation(автоматтау) - бағдарланатын қосымшаларды жасау технологиясы, ол осы қосымшалардың ішкі  қызметтеріне бағдарламалық жетуді қамтамасыз етеді.   Обьектілер функциясын шақыру үшін арнайы интерфейс - диспинтерфейс(dipinterface) түсінігін енгізеді. Бұл технологияны, мысалы Microsoft Excel  қолдайды, ол басқа қосымшаларға өз қызметтерін ұсыны алады. 

ActiveX - технология, OLE-automation негізінде құрылған технология,  бір ДК-де  шоғырланған, сондай-ақ  желіде таратылған БҚАМ -ды құру үшін арналған. 

CORBA технологиясы, CORBA обьектілері және интерфейстері  негізіндегі COM-ға ұқсас әдісті орындайды. Бұл технологияны барлық негізгі таратылған БҚАМ-дарды жасау үшін әртекті есептеу орталарында қолдануға болады.

SELECT таңдау операторына толық түсінік.

Qbasic тілінде таңдау командасы  үшін арналған ыңғайлы, құрылымдық SELECT – CASE операторы бар. (Select – таңдау, Case – жағдай).

             Жазылу үлгісі:

      SELECT CASE <айнымалы>  CASE<1-мән>: <1-блок>

CASE<2-мән>: <2-блок> 

   END SELECT

        Жалпы  жағдайда Case қызметші сөзінің параметрлері IS (IS - болу) сөзінін басталатын өрнек.  Таңдау командасын SELECT – CASE операторын  пайдаланып жазу программаны  құрылымдық түрде жазу талабына  сәйкес келеді.

SQL стандарты кезеңдері.

1989ж алғашқы халықаралық SQL ( SQL-89) тілінің стандарты шыққаннан кейін, 1982ж екінші халықаралық SQL-92 стандарты қабылданды. Осыдан кейін МББЖ бейімделген SQL тілі туралы айтуға болатын болды. Кез келген SQL тілді қолдану үшін стандарт тілдерін білу қажет.

SQL тілінің стандарттау жұмысы оның ең алғашқы коммерциялық реализациясы басталғанмен тұспа–тұс келеді. Стандарт негізінде SQLSYSTEMR қолдануға тиым салынған еді. Оны реализациялау қиынға түскен еді.

1989ж қабылданған халықаралық SQL стандарттарының көп бөлімі бірдей болып келеді. Бұл стандартта МБ схемасын басқару және динамикалық SQL деген тарау мүлдем жоқ.

Осының негізінде SQL-2 стандартын шығару жұмысы басталған болатын. Бұл да быраз жылға созылып, ақырында 1992 ж наурыз айында біткен еді (оны енді SQL-92 деп атайды). Бұл стандарт толық және реализацияға қажет аспектілерді қамтиды: МБ схемасын басқару, транзакция мен сессияларды басқару (сессия басқару дегеніміз транзакцияның уақыт қатынастарының сақтала тізбектелуі), МБ қосылуы, динамикалық SQL.

SQL-2 стандартын аяқтай келе, SQL-3 стандартын шығару жұмысы басталып еді. SQL-3 триггерлер механизмі және абстрактілі мәліметтерді қолдану мүмкіндігін қамтиды.

Қолданылуы

Бұл сандарт М.Б. –сы тілінің семантикасы мен синтаксисін анықтайды.

  1. Мәліметтер базасы құрылымы мен шегінің сұлбасын анықтайтын тіл.

  2. Мәліметтер базасында белгілі бір оператоорды орындауды басқаратын тіл.

Бұл стандарт мәліметтерінің логикалық құрылымын анықтайды. Ол мәліметтер базасын жобалауға, басқаруға және қорғауға мүмкіндік береді.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]